&lt;p&gt;&lt;b&gt;New page&lt;/b&gt;&lt;/p&gt;&lt;div&gt;== [CHALLENGE] Is the &amp;#039;Constraint Engine&amp;#039; Framing Just the Executive Function Error in Reverse? ==&lt;br /&gt;
&lt;br /&gt;
The article&amp;#039;s claim that the prefrontal cortex is a &amp;#039;constraint engine&amp;#039; rather than an &amp;#039;executive officer&amp;#039; is presented as a correction to the executive function fallacy. I think it is the same fallacy, merely inverted.&lt;br /&gt;
&lt;br /&gt;
Both framings assume a dualistic architecture: there is a part of the brain that &amp;#039;does&amp;#039; something to the rest. The executive function framework treats the PFC as the controller; the constraint-engine framework treats it as the brake. But both are control-theoretic metaphors imported from engineering, and both may misrepresent what the PFC actually does.&lt;br /&gt;
&lt;br /&gt;
The emerging picture from predictive processing and active inference suggests a different model: the PFC is not a controller or a brake but a hierarchical predictor. It maintains high-level generative models of temporal structure — what will happen, in what order, over what timescale — and its &amp;#039;suppression&amp;#039; of amygdala-driven signals is not braking but prediction-error minimization. The &amp;#039;impulsivity&amp;#039; observed in PFC damage is not the loss of constraint but the loss of temporally deep models: the organism can no longer represent future states with sufficient precision to guide present action.&lt;br /&gt;
&lt;br /&gt;
If this is right, then calling the PFC a &amp;#039;constraint engine&amp;#039; is like calling a GPS a &amp;#039;brake on random driving.&amp;#039; It is not wrong, exactly, but it mistakes the mechanism for the function. The function is not suppression. It is structured prediction across time.&lt;br /&gt;
&lt;br /&gt;
I challenge the article&amp;#039;s authors to defend the constraint-engine framing against the predictive processing alternative, or to explain why both are wrong and a third model is needed. The stakes are not merely terminological. If the PFC is a predictor, then disorders of &amp;#039;executive function&amp;#039; are disorders of temporal modeling, not of willpower or self-control. That reframing has direct implications for how we treat ADHD, addiction, and impulsivity — and for how we design AI systems that need to balance immediate and delayed rewards.&lt;br /&gt;
